Stronghold Crusader: Definitive Edition is out now, after much anticipation from its over 230,000 wishlists and more than 195,000 demo downloads. For those who haven’t heard of it, this real-time tactics city builder was originally released back in 2002, and this remake was developed and published by Firefly Studios. Despite its recent release, the title already reached over 2,000 reviews and a 90% Very Positive score on Steam.

Thanks to technological advancements and accrued developer knowledge, the game has gotten a glow-up for players new and old to enjoy. This includes Lords and Trails of two DLCs, better graphics, and smoother gameplay.

So, what can you expect from Stronghold Crusader: Definitive Edition?

  • Eight new playable units.
  • 20 AI Lords, including four new ones.
  • Various additional campaigns: two single-player historical ones, four Sands of Time trails, and a new co-op trail.
  • Various modes, including PvP of up to eight players.
  • Larger map sizes.
  • Better graphics.
  • Workshop support for custom scenarios.
  • Remastered music
  • Custom options and quality-of-life improvements.
